Native Asset Mapping

Native Asset Mapping is the primary innovative feature of the VSC protocol that enables users to send and receive native assets between different blockchains wallet addresses, through VSC, reducing concerns about chain compatibility.

It allows users to send, for example, SOL from a Solana wallet to an Ethereum wallet address. The recipient receives native SOL, viewable and usable on VSC when they log in with their Ethereum wallet. The received SOL tokens remain in the VSC vault on the Solana mainnet and are secured by the VSC protocol validator system. By completing the transaction, the ownership of those tokens is transferred to the account receiving the SOL.

Native Asset Mapping links a user’s single wallet address (e.g., ETH) to their VSC account, enabling them to receive native assets from any supported blockchain even if those assets originate from a different chain than the wallet they connected.

  1. User connects to VSC using one wallet - for example, their Solana wallet.
  2. Sender deposits Sol tokens to VSC. Under the “transfer” option, the sender inputs the receiver’s ETH address. (This differs from cross-chain atomic swaps, another key functionality of VSC)
  3. VSC maps the incoming asset to the ETH address on its internal ledger. (Transfers within VSC incur no direct transaction fees to users)
  4. The receiver logs in with their ETH wallet and sees the deposited asset (e.g., SOL).
  5. The receiver can now swap, withdraw, or use the asset within VSC.
